The Hoover Criminal Gang's were once Crips, the word "Hoover" comes from a blvd of the same name that runs through certain areas in South Central Los Angeles. The Hoover Criminals came out of the Gangster Crip sets, but around 1979, the Gangster Crip sets began feuding with the Neighborhood Crip sets.... The Latin Kings were the first non-African American Chicago gang to reach the suburbs. This first attempt was made in the suburb of Cicero when a Little Village Latin King nicknamed "Serbian John" made Johnny's Top Hat night club at 22 nd and Cicero Ave his hangout for him and a group of Latin Kings.

The Vice Lords have a hierarchical chain of command. There are "kings" and "princes" that rule the Vice Lords. In particular locations, "universal elites" run the particular sets within an area or city. These universal elites are ranked as five-star (highest), three-star, and one-star.The Vice Lords have been known by many names and many acts since being founded in the Chicago-area juvenile detention facility at St. Charles around 1957. Also called the Almighty Vice Lords and the Conservative Vice Lord Nation, the gang has morphed from petty crime to drug trafficking to white collar crime over the course of decades. billings computer repair United Blood Nation [21] Notable members.
